Where To Eat & Drink With Out-Of-Towners - Austin - The Infatuation

"Whisler’s has all the makings of an impressing-out-of-towners slam dunk: an always-happening patio scene, a secret upstairs mezcal bar, and the excellent food trailer Golden Tiger parked on the patio. It’s a great kicking-off point for a full night of East Side eating and drinking activities." - nicolai mccrary, chelsea bucklew, katherine lewin
